Default Eset smart security, Nod32.... Problems with Vista SP2.

Ive just had a load of problems with Eset smart security/Nod32 where it kept saying "Maximum protection is not ensured" and also "Personal firewall is not working properly".

This all started after the Vista 32 bit SP2 download, as a test i uninstalled the SP2 download and Eset smart security is now working perfectly again. This is mainly to warn other people that maybe using Eset smart security/Nod32 that if you start getting problems then its probably down to the SP2 download.

This is from Eset themselves which i just found via a google search as i was looking into a way of trying to update to SP2 and to keep my current version of Eset Smart Security which is version 4, you can`t do it, version 4 is incompatible with SP2 and they are working on a fix for it.
